Transaction 8059d3130f34dbc9d0422eabf2aa3b56582183d8be4249b74e567d09b5fad2a5
2 Input
2 Outputs
- 8059d3130f34dbc9d0422eabf2aa3b56582183d8be4249b74e567d09b5fad2a5:0
- 8059d3130f34dbc9d0422eabf2aa3b56582183d8be4249b74e567d09b5fad2a5:1
value 758720992
address 169Usc1P3uDATejkFDrWpyPTbRZPYS2Fka
value 70000000
address 1sUUdWRdo2maDWaDhr1fzPcp1hKS7rGrm